Former cabinet minister Dame Penny Mordaunt celebrates the traditions and ceremonies that underpin British life and argues that they promote values, encourage reflection and act as an antidote to nationalism.

Mordaunt is co-author with Chris Lewis of Pomp and Circumstance. They explore ancient and new customs, from coronations and national ceremonies to local customs. Mordaunt, who presented the Sword of Offering to King Charles III at his coronation, says Britain uses its historical conventions to navigate the future. She argues that nations and communities that have them thrive, while those without them find it harder to adapt to a changing world.
